County, City, Or Town Appeal Procedure

50-60-303. County, city, or town appeal procedure. (1) If a county, city, or town adopts a building code, it shall also establish an appeal procedure by ordinance or resolution, as appropriate, that is acceptable to the department.

(2) If a county, city, or town does not adopt a code, appeals on the application of the state building code within the county, city, or town must be made to the department.

History: En. Sec. 13, Ch. 366, L. 1969; amd. Sec. 11, Ch. 226, L. 1974; R.C.M. 1947, 69-2116; amd. Sec. 3, Ch. 546, L. 2001; amd. Sec. 17, Ch. 443, L. 2003.
